    Daily exercise and a balanced diet. Not the most fun in the world, and definitely off-putting after a day or so of perseverence. However, a month of daily aerobic exercise (30 minutes to an hour is fine) will reap benefits, and make you feel 'trific.

    It's just a matter of figuring out what to do, how to do it properly, getting into a routine, and sticking to it.
